While mobile payments are not expected to go mainstream in 2012, merchants can expect this year to be another breakthrough year for m-commerce and related technology.In its annual survey of mobile insiders, industry analyst Chetan Sharma Consulting found nearly 60 percent of respondents claim mobile payments will experience a breakthrough this year, and 40 percent said the same for mobile commerce. Last year, less than 50 percent cited mobile payments as the breakthrough category for 2011.
Interestingly, market insiders pointed to the financial services industry as most likely to define the mobile payment services space in 2012, with nearly 40 percent of respondents agreeing with this sentiment. That figure is up from 30 percent in last year's survey.
"Interestingly, after a year of moves by mobile carriers worldwide to control mobile payments, the number of panelists who believe operators will control mobile payments actually dropped from last year," reports Mobile Payments Today. "In 2011, around 17 percent of respondents said operators would define the space. That number fell to 12 percent this year."
